demarches-simplifiees / demarches-simplifiees.fr

Dématérialiser et simplifier les démarches administratives
https://www.demarches-simplifiees.fr
GNU Affero General Public License v3.0
190 stars 89 forks source link

conditionnel : quand je modifie la valeur d'un champ qui condtionne d'autre champs, les données des champs qui ne sont plus visible devraient être ecrasées #10090

Open mfo opened 7 months ago

mfo commented 7 months ago

hs: https://secure.helpscout.net/conversation/2528642727/2058977

contexte

J'en profite aussi pour soumettre aux devs un problème relevé récemment : dans le cas d'un formulaire dupliqué avec conditionnel, les champs conditionnés sélectionnés lors du 1er formulaire ne sont pas remis à zéro lors de la duplication. Par exemple un champ Région qui conditionne un champ département peut conduire à des dépôts de dossier dans lequel l'usager va pouvoir choisir une nouvelle région et un nouveau département mais l'ancien champ département va rester activé. ce qui peut donner à l'export et sur le tableau de bord :

comprehension

quand on change un champ conditionnel, il se peut que des valeur de ses sous champs aient ete saisies. auquel cas il faudrait vider les données associées a ce champs. ou ne pas les exporter (ex: les PJ, mais aussi les excell etc...)

colinux commented 7 months ago

A priori, c'est une feature assumée. Pratique pour l'usager tant qu'il saisit son dossier en brouillon. Peut-être une régression fonctionnelle sur les exports introduite depuis le changement sur les types de champs / révisions. Mais ça empêche pas de cleaner lorsque le dossier passe en construction

mfo commented 7 months ago

se sont des problèmes au moment de l'export non ?